SJAC Suspension Notice

In light of the most recent government advice, the uncertainty and risks to personal health and well-being along with that of the wider community, we have determined all training sessions are suspended with immediate effect and until further notice.


During this time, which will undoubtedly be hard and testing for the very best of us, I ask that you remain kind and thoughtful.


We anticipate there will be tough moments ahead for many.


One of the greatest strengths of the club over the years has been how it has pulled together. I speak often and proudly of the family that is Slough Junior AC. Now is a time when the true strengths of that family will shine through as we offer and give support to one another.


That support may be through a simple message, a ‘phone call, an offer to help others out with something - these “little things” will all count in the weeks and potentially months ahead. You’d be amazed at the difference bringing a small comfort, even a smile to someone’s face will make in the times ahead.


It is also really important that you keep yourselves fit and moving. The temptation to sit and do nothing will have massive appeal. A fit body helps lead to a fit mind, which is going to be so important if you are in isolation or just all at home all of the time - something we are not used to.


I will post out some simple ideas on things you can do in the front room or in your garden to keep moving (and not climbing up the wall as you go stir crazy) and have fun whilst doing it…share your thoughts - we may even have a small club competition to see who comes up with the best ideas and celebrate those when we are all back together in the hopefully not too distant future.


We will let you know as soon as we believe it is right and appropriate to restart our sessions in whatever format we can - we really want you doing active, fun stuff….


Keep well, keep fit, and above all keep healthy (and stay in touch…)



Conrad J Rowland

Chairman
